Abstract
Author: Dilan Demircioglu
Title: The best interst of the child comes first
Supervisor: Anders Lundberg
The intention of this essay was to investigate and gain understanding on how social-workers work with unaccompanied children, with the aim of what is considered in the best interest of the child. What is considered being the best inters of the child child has many different contexts, and there are different suggestions on how it should be taken into account. Is there one right way, or are there many different ways to consider as the best for a child? A qualitative approach has been used in order to reach the results of this study. The paper is made of semi structured interviews by five social workers, and their experiences as well as their reasoning regarding what is seen as the best interest of the child. The respondents in the paper are all social workers experienced and working with unaccompanied refugee children. The collected material has been analyzed from a cultural perspective, social constructive perspective, as well as ecology of human development. The material states that there is no denomination on what the best interest of a child implies. The meaning of what the best interest of the child depends completely on the way one interpret the concept, and also the environment every separate child is in. All individuals have different needs and every need differentiate itself from micro- to macro levels, which means that every individuals need is different in relation to other individuals need, as well as each country have different needs. The best interest of a child is a combination of what is considered to be the most positive and fortunate for each child's development.
